Checking Compatibility

Before purchasing new RAM, it’s essential to check the compatibility of the upgrade with the Toshiba laptop. This involves identifying the type of RAM used by the laptop, such as DDR3, DDR4, or DDR5, and the maximum capacity it can support. Users can find this information in the laptop’s user manual, on the manufacturer’s website, or by checking the specifications of the existing RAM modules. Additionally, ensuring that the new RAM modules are compatible with the laptop’s memory slots and speed is crucial for a successful upgrade.

Identifying RAM Specifications

To identify the RAM specifications of a Toshiba laptop, users can follow these steps:
– Open the laptop’s user manual or visit the Toshiba website to find the specifications of the model.
– Look for the section on memory or RAM to find details on the type, speed, and maximum capacity.
– If the information is not available, users can check the existing RAM modules by accessing the laptop’s memory compartment.

Step-by-Step Upgrade Instructions

The process of upgrading the RAM for a Toshiba laptop typically involves the following steps:
– Shut down the laptop and unplug the power cord.
– Locate the memory compartment, usually found at the bottom or side of the laptop.
– Remove the screws or clips holding the compartment cover in place.
– Gently pull out the existing RAM modules from their slots.
– Align the new RAM modules with the slots, ensuring the notches match.
– Firmly push the new RAM modules into the slots until they click into place.
– Replace the compartment cover and reattach any screws or clips.
– Reconnect the power cord and turn on the laptop to verify the upgrade.

Post-Upgrade Verification

After completing the RAM upgrade, it’s essential to verify that the new memory is recognized by the laptop. Users can do this by:
– Checking the laptop’s system properties or device specifications to confirm the increased RAM.
– Running memory-intensive applications to test the performance improvement.
– Monitoring the laptop’s performance over time to ensure the upgrade has made a positive impact.

How much RAM do I need to upgrade to for optimal performance in my Toshiba laptop?

The amount of RAM you need to upgrade to for optimal performance in your Toshiba laptop depends on your specific usage and requirements. If you’re a casual user who primarily uses your laptop for web browsing, email, and office work, 4GB or 8GB of RAM may be sufficient. However, if you’re a power user who runs multiple resource-intensive applications, such as video editing software, games, or virtual machines, you may need 16GB or more of RAM. It’s essential to consider your specific needs and usage patterns to determine the optimal amount of RAM for your Toshiba laptop.

Can I mix and match different types of RAM in my Toshiba laptop?

It’s generally not recommended to mix and match different types of RAM in your Toshiba laptop. Using different types of RAM, such as DDR3 and DDR4, can cause compatibility issues and affect performance. Additionally, mixing RAM with different speeds, capacities, or manufacturers can also lead to problems. To ensure optimal performance and compatibility, it’s best to use identical RAM modules, with the same specifications and manufacturer.

How do I troubleshoot issues after upgrading the RAM in my Toshiba laptop?

If you encounter issues after upgrading the RAM in your Toshiba laptop, such as errors, crashes, or slow performance, there are several troubleshooting steps you can take. First, ensure that the RAM is properly seated and secured in the slots. Next, check the BIOS settings to ensure that the new RAM is recognized and configured correctly. You can also try running a memory test to identify any issues with the RAM. Additionally, check for any software conflicts or updates that may be causing the issues.
